References to monetary behaviour (19)

Place of Transaction Authority Transaction Type Purpose/Focus Context/Field of Action Commodity Monetary Material Coin Denomination/Unit of Monetary Measurement Lines Notes
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a City Spending Public office Gymnasium ll. 1-30 Metrodoros' gymnasiarchy, funded partly by him and the city.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Individual Spending Public office Gymnasium ll. 1-30 Metrodoros' gymnasiarchy, funded partly by him and the city.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Individual Spending Sacrifices and games Gymnasium ll. 3-5 Conducted sacrifices and attendant games in a gymnasium context.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Uncertain Spending Statue Honorific ll. 4-5 Mention of the setting up of a statue.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Individual Spending Dedication (athletic prizes) Gymnasium ll. 5-6 Set up prizes for the youth.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Individual Spending Youth training and education Gymnasium ll. 7-9 Oversaw the care of the presbuteroi.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Individual Spending Construction Gymnasium ll. 9-11 Built troughs in the gymnasium.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Individual Spending Construction Civic ll. 12-15 Built public-washing basins with sponges.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Individual Spending Dedication Religious ll. 15-17 Dedicated a shield to Hermes.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Association Spending Crown Honorific Gold ll. 17-19
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a City Spending Public burial Honorific ll. 19-23 Metrodoros oversaw the running of public funerals.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a City Spending Festival Religious ll. 23-27 Processions conducted by the city, presumably in the context of festivals.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Individual Spending Sacrifices Religious ll. 28-29 Made epidoseis towards other festival-days.
http://nomisma.org/id/nacrasa Individual Spending Festival Religious ll. 29-30 Contributed towards the Kabeiria festival.
